This Sina and Alibaba Strategic Cooperation Agreement (this "Agreement") is entered into in Beijing on this 29th day of April 2013 by and between Party A and Party B.

Whereas,

1. Party A and its Affiliates operate online platforms such as Sina (www.sina.com.cn) and Sina Weibo (www.weibo.com.cn, www.weibo.com, and www.weibo.cn); while Party B and its Affiliates operate online platforms such as Alibaba (www.alibaba.com), Taobao (www.taobao.com), Tmall (www.tmall.com), eTao (www.etao.com), Alipay (www.alipay.com) and Juhuasuan (ju.taobao.com).

2. The parties desire to fully leverage on their respective strengths, to establish a comprehensive strategic partnership, and to build an extensive cooperation framework covering the business segments and user bases of both parties. The parties further desire to derive values and benefits arising from such cooperation in accordance with the principles of mutual benefit, mutual growth and mutual synergies to be gained from each other. The cooperation between the parties shall include, without limitation, integration of the parties' respective online platform accounts, inter-linking and sharing of data, introduction and development of new marketing products and services and providing users of both parties with diverse, efficient, valuable and convenient e-commerce and marketing services.


NOW, THEREFORE, after friendly consultations, the parties agree as follows:

2. Cooperation

2.1 Accounts Interoperability

The parties shall accomplish the interoperability of Party A Weibo Accounts and Party B Taobao Accounts:


  2.1.1 The parties shall ensure that any Party A User can directly log in to the Taobao Platform using its Weibo Account and any Party B User can directly log in to the Weibo Platform using its Taobao Account. Party A shall place a "Login Using Your Taobao Account" display button on the login page of the Weibo Platform. Party B shall place a "Login Using Your Weibo Account" display button on the login page of the Taobao Account. The text on the display button may be changed subject to further discussions between the parties; and where either party wishes to amend such text, the other party shall provide its cooperation in connection therewith.

  2.1.2 When a Party B User logs in to the Weibo Platform using its Taobao Account, Party A shall check whether such User has a Weibo Account. If yes, Party A shall direct such Party B User to link its Taobao Account with its Weibo Account; and if not, Party A shall direct such Party B User to register and activate a Weibo Account and simultaneously link its Taobao Account with such Weibo Account. Likewise, when a Party A User logs in to the Taobao Platform using its Weibo Account, Party B shall check whether such User has a Taobao Account. If so, Party B shall direct such Party A User to link its Weibo Account with its Taobao Account; and if not, Party B shall direct such Party A User to register and activate a Taobao Account and simultaneously link its Weibo Account with such Taobao Account. The parties acknowledge that the parties shall ensure the right of choice of each User and shall guide but not force the User to link or register accounts.

3


  2.1.3 For account safety purposes, after a Party A User logs in to the Taobao Platform using its Weibo Account, Party B shall have the right to request such Party A User to submit additional information (including, without limitation, identification information and security verification information). The receipt of such requested information by Party B may be made a condition to a Party A User being provided access to all of the functions that Party B offers to Users with Taobao Accounts. The implementation plan of the above-mentioned submission of additional information shall be prepared by Party B. Likewise, after a Party B User logs in to the Weibo Platform using its Taobao Account, Party A shall have the right to request such Party B User to submit additional information (including, without limitation, identification information and security verification information). The receipt of such requested information by Party A may be made a condition to a Party B User being provided access to all of the functions that Party A offers to Users with Weibo Accounts. The implementation plan of the above-mentioned submission of additional information shall be prepared by Party A.

  2.1.4 The parties agree that the interoperability between Party A Weibo Accounts and Party B Taobao Accounts is the first step of the account interoperation process between the parties. The parties shall work together towards achieving the account interoperability between Party A Weibo Accounts and Party B accounts in accordance with the principles same as those set forth in Sections 2.1.1 to 2.1.3 hereof. In particular, Party B agrees that, after Party B launches its unified account LOGO functions, Party B shall work towards implementing the account interoperability between Party B unified accounts and Party A Weibo Accounts expeditiously.

2.4 Cooperation in Alipay Business

  2.4.1 To the extent permitted by applicable laws, regulations and industry rules, when the Users make payment via the Weibo Wallet of Party A on the Weibo Platform, Party A agrees that it shall list Alipay as the preferred third party payment tool on the Weibo Wallet page and encourage Users to use Alipay.

  2.4.2 The parties agree to further cooperate by including other payment methods and products with respect to transactions conducted on the Weibo Platform for non-Taobao Platform items or merchandises.

9


2.4.3 The parties agree to actively cooperate with each other in the payment service business.

2.5 Cooperation in Wireless Business

Unless otherwise agreed with respect to the contents of the wireless user-ends, the parties shall implement simultaneously all the cooperation referred to in Sections 2.1 to 2.4 hereof on both PC user-ends and wireless user-ends. The parties shall explore and cooperate in the wireless user-ends to provide products and business resolutions applicable to a wireless environment, which includes, but not limited to the following:


  2.5.1 after a User clicks on the Taobao merchandise link appearing on the Weibo Platform and arrives at the payment link, without sacrificing such User's customer experience LOGO , the Weibo client-end will prompt the secure payment module of Alipay to complete the payment;

  2.5.2 each of Party A and Party B will to a certain extent promote the APP of the other Party, including, promoting the Taobao client-end and the Alipay mobile express payment module by Party A via its application center, and promoting Party A's APP by Party B via its application center. The parties shall consider cooperating in the business of two-dimensional codes. The specific forms and contents of such cooperation will be separately discussed by the parties.

2.6 Cooperation in Marketing Business

  2.6.1 Party A will offer advertising resource space on Sina and the Weibo Platform, and work with Party B to allocate the resources efficiently, which will be carried out in the following two ways: (1) if Party B purchases an exclusive right to use such resources within a certain period ("Buyout" or "Buy Out") at a fixed price, Party B will use such resource space by using its Tanx code; and the parties shall evaluate the value of the resource space and negotiate the price in accordance with the normal media procurement process, and Party B shall be responsible for selling the given network flow of such resource space to its clients; and (2) if Party B does not Buy Out such advertising resource space, then Party A shall provide its Private Exchange system for Party B to publish the promotional information.

  2.6.2 Party A will offer top-of-the-page advertising space to be sold through a bidding process, which will be connected to Party B's system through the API provided by the Weibo advertisement launching system. Party B shall be responsible for selling such advertising space to its clients, and shall encourage its clients to participate in the bidding for such advertising space directly or indirectly through the use of Party B's services. Party B's clients or Party B shall pay the appropriate fees to Party A based on the results of the bidding through the Weibo advertisement launching system.

10


  2.6.3 The parties shall cooperate to develop new information-flow-based advertisement products on the Weibo Platform, and for every single piece of information published on the Weibo Platform (including, without limitation, the information originally published on the Weibo Platform and the information shared through the Taobao Platform) containing a link to the Taobao Platform merchandise, Party A will increase Party B's advertising space and grant Party B the exclusive right to sell such advertising space. If Party A offers such advertising space and grants Party B such exclusive right of sale, Party B shall share the revenue so generated with Party A. The proportion shall be further negotiated and determined by the parties; provided that Party A's proportional entitlement shall not be less than 70%. The parties agree that in line with the development of this business, the parties may further discuss and determine whether to further increase Party A's proportional entitlement. The parties undertake to provide the relevant products, technology, data and interface support to achieve the development of the above information-flow-based advertisement products. Party A shall have the right to determine the frequency of or rules related to such products.

  2.6.4 Pursuant to Section 2.1 (Account Interoperability) and Section 2.2 (Cooperation in User Products), Party A shall provide Party B with the public promotion plugins LOGO to connect with the system of Party B. Party B will use such public promotion plugins in its existing marketing tools (including, without limitation, the Through Train LOGO and Taobao Alliance LOGO . Party B shall pay Party A fees for such use, which shall be calculated based on every one thousand public promotion plugin prompt received. Party B shall, in its sole discretion, determine the extent to which such public promotion plugin shall be prompted based on usage and the cost-to-revenue ratio.

  2.6.5 In the advertising environment offered by Party A, if Party B uses Party A's public promotion plugins in the advertisement research space it Buys out, the rules referred to in Section 2.6.4 shall apply; but if Party B does not Buy out the advertisement research space and publish advertisement via Party A's Private Exchange system, Party A shall provide the public promotion plugins for free in accordance with applicable rules of Party A.

11


  2.6.6 The parties agree that Party A (or a Party A Contract Entity) and Party B (or a Party B Contract Entity) shall further enter into a Marketing Cooperation Contract in respect of the detailed arrangements for the use of resources, placement of frames and launch of products in connection with the proposed marketing cooperation; the pricing, settlement method and settlement intervals related thereto shall be further set forth in the Marketing Cooperation Contract.

2.9 Cooperation Revenue and Settlement

  2.9.1 Party B undertakes that for each of the first three years of the cooperation contemplated hereunder, the minimum revenue to be received by Party A in connection with any and all cooperation activities contemplated hereunder (the "Party A Revenue"), including any and all revenue to be directly paid or forwarded by Party B to Party A, but unless otherwise specifically agreed between the parties, excluding a portion of the marketing cooperation revenue (up to RMB 50 million) generated during the same year from any non-Weibo-Platform resources (including, without limitation, Sina (www.sina.com.cn) and mobile Sina (3g.sina.cn)) as described in Section 2.6 herein above, shall be as follows: RMB 425 million for the first year, RMB 745 million for the second year, and RMB 1.175 billion for the third year.

13


Notwithstanding the foregoing, in no event, for any particular year, may the percentage of the marketing cooperation revenue generated from the non-Weibo-Platform resources that is to be included into the above-specified minimum revenue for such year exceed 15% of such minimum revenue.


  2.9.2 The parties agree that Party B will use its best efforts to procure that the Party A Revenue to be generated from the above-described cooperation will be achieved through marketing cooperation resources, in connection with which, the detailed proposal for implementation of payment and achievement shall be subject to the Marketing Cooperation Contract. The parties shall settle Party A Revenue on a quarterly basis. Prior to each settlement, the parties shall confirm the relevant data. Within the first fifteen (15) business days of each quarter, Party B shall make payment of Party A Revenue actually generated during the previous quarter. If the parties are unable to confirm the relevant data prior to any settlement, the parties agree that either party shall have the right to choose a qualified third party independent agency to audit such data, and the parties shall accept the results audited by such agency. Any fees and expenses arising therefrom shall be borne by the party providing the incorrect data. The parties acknowledge that, in case of any discrepancy between the settlement terms in any Implementation Agreement and that in this Agreement, the provisions in such Implementation Agreement shall prevail.

  2.9.3 The parties agree that Party B's revenue to be generated from the above-described cooperation (including any and all revenue to be directly paid or forwarded by Party A to Party B, the "Party B Revenue") shall be settled on a quarterly basis and prior to each settlement the parties shall confirm the relevant data. Within the first fifteen (15) business days of each quarter, Party A shall make payment of the Party B Revenue actually generated in the previous quarter. If the parties are unable to confirm the relevant data prior to the settlement, the parties agree that either party may have the right to choose a qualified third party independent agency to audit such data, and the parties shall accept the results audited by such agency. Any fees and expenses arising therefrom shall be borne by the party providing the incorrect data. The parties acknowledge that, in case of any discrepancy between the settlement terms in any Implementation Agreement and that in this Agreement, the provisions in such Implementation Agreement shall prevail.

14


  2.9.4 If, as of the end of a particular year, the aggregated Party A Revenue in such year fails to reach the minimum revenue specified for such year, and Party A has provided the resources and/or traffic as agreed under the Marketing Cooperation Contract, Party B undertakes that it shall pay Party A the difference between the aggregated Party A Revenue and the minimum revenue for such year ("Shortfall"), together with the payment for the last quarter of such year. If Party B is unable to achieve the minimum revenue due to the failure of Party A in providing the relevant agreed resources, Party B shall not be liable to pay any Shortfall or assume any other liabilities. For the purpose of this Section 2.9.4, (i) the first year shall commence on the date of execution of this Agreement and end on the last day of the then current fiscal year of Party A; (ii) the succeeding two years shall be the fiscal years of Party A; and (iii) a year shall refer to the fiscal year of Party A and the year end shall refer to the end of the fiscal year of Party A.

2.10 Exclusivity

Party A and Party B agree that the cooperation under this Agreement is non-exclusive; provided, however, that either party shall not, and shall ensure that its Affiliates will not, undertake cooperation with Tencent (or any of Tencent's Affiliates) that is the same or similar to the cooperation specified in Section 2 hereof as a whole, except for participating in business cooperation in a market-oriented method LOGO The parties agree that any cooperation arrangements between Party B and Tencent that exist as of the date of execution of this Agreement (the "Existing Cooperation") shall not be subject to the restrictions under this Section 2.10; provided that, after the date of execution of this Agreement, Party B and Tencent shall not make any substantial change and expansion with respect to the Existing Cooperation and shall not breach the foregoing covenants.

12. Effectiveness, Renewal and Termination

12.1 The term of this Agreement commences from April 29, 2013 and ends on January 15, 2016, and will automatically renew for two (2) years upon the expiration of this Agreement unless one party notifies the other party of its intention of non-renewal. The provisions regarding Party A's minimum revenue shall not be extended to the automatic renewal term.

12.2 Notwithstanding any other provisions contained herein, either party shall have the right to terminate this Agreement without assuming any liabilities of breach, in the event any of the following circumstances occurs:

  12.2.1 the other party commits a material breach of this Agreement causing the objectives hereof unachievable, and such breach is not remedied within thirty (30) days following receipt of a written notice; or

22


  12.2.2 the other party is insolvent, becomes the subject of liquidation/dissolution proceedings, or is being transferred for the benefit of creditors; or its businesses are being assigned to receivers (excluding any voluntary liquidation for the purpose of reorganization or merger);

12.3 Notwithstanding any other provisions hereof, Party B shall have the right to terminate this Agreement without assuming any liabilities of breach if a change of control occurs to Party A. Party A shall notify Party B in writing as soon as practicable before an event that triggers a Change of Control occurs. In respect of Party A, a "Change of Control" means the conclusion of any transaction or a series of transactions (including issuance of new shares, transfer of issued shares, and amendment to an agreement in relation to right of control), regardless of whether Weibo Corporation, Party A or Beijing Weimeng Chuangke Network Technology Co., Ltd. LOGO (each, a "Weibo Company") is a party to such transaction or series of transactions; upon the consummation of such transaction or series of transactions, Sina Corporation (i) ceases to hold, directly or indirectly, shares representing fifty percent (50%) or more of the equity interests or voting rights in a Weibo Company, or (ii) ceases to have the right to elect fifty percent (50%) or more of the board members of a Weibo Company, or (iii) ceases to possess, either directly or indirectly or through one or more intermediaries, the right to direct or cause other person to direct the management or policies of a Weibo Company, whether through ownership of voting securities, by contract or by other meanings.
